HOW YOULL MAKE AN IMPACT
As a General Manager, Marketing (Trauma and CMF-Craniomaxillofacial) youll play a vital role in advancing our mission. In this position, youll be responsible for leading a customer focused business unit and franchise, consisting of medical and operational staff with significant subject matter expertise. Markets medical and scientific capabilities to clients, working as and in conjunction with business development teams and operations to develop new customers and build existing established relationships. Responsible for improving existing products, developing and implementing innovative professional marketing programs to ensure successful product launches and continued market share growth of the Companys existing products. Profit and Loss responsibility of the Franchise.
Your work will have purpose every single day, contributing directly to life-changing outcomes.
WHAT YOULL DO
- Strategic: Utilizes key business models such as a SWOT, segmentation, product life cycle, and GAP analysis to aid in the development, implementation, and positioning of product lines. Accumulates, analyzes, and, and evaluates key data about the marketplace, including areas such as market size, growth movement, and competition, to help anticipate competitive movements and make recommendations for product positioning in the marketplace. Validates new product design, functionality and clinical applications with customers as well as developing marketing and sales plans. Develops and implements pricing and product offering strategies based on customer needs and processing feasibility. Ensures departmental compliance with all relevant regulatory standards.
- Leadership: Performs day-to-day management of the Franchise and provides oversight to assigned team by leading, guiding, and directing employees to be effective team members. Ensure that everyone is equipped with the right skills, tools, and talents necessary for executing their duties using established people processes. Collaborates and provides ongoing product and service support to representatives of LifeNet and its partners. Works closely with R&D teams to support new product development and launch efforts.
- Financial: Develops and implements strategic and annual marketing plans to include short-term, mid-term, and long-term goals and objectives for the respective product family. This includes situational analysis of products, revenue forecasts, competitive analysis, and identification of key opportunities and threats. Evaluates the product-marketing plan to ensure compatibility with LifeNet mission. Develops and executes product launch strategies. Responsible for the Franchise Profit and Loss.
- Relationship/Partnering: Develops and maintains relationships with key opinion leaders in the surgical community relative to the product family to aid in new product development and positioning of current product lines. Builds relationships with and works effectively with both direct and distributor sales teams.
- Education & Training: Utilizes key communication and promotional tools to establish awareness and feedback from the target audience and potential users. This may involve the utilization of external resources for the development of clinical education programs, sales collateral marketing materials, and other associated brand awareness activities. Conducts focus groups to advance.
WHAT YOULL BRING
Minimum Requirements:
- Bachelors Degree: Marketing, Business, or related field
- TEN (10) Years Business experience in Medical Sales/Marketing and Product Management; majority should be with manufacturers of medical products ideally within the broadly defined market in which the Franchise in based; previous experience interacting with the surgical community and surgeons
- EIGHT (8) Years People leadership experience with direct reports
- FIVE (5) Years Experience in the development and market introduction of new and transformational products
- FIVE (5) Years Experience in the industry pertaining to the Franchise
- Valid State Drivers License
Preferred Experience/Skills/Certifications:
- Masters Degree
Key Knowledge, Skills, & Abilities:
- Franchise-related industry knowledge: In-depth knowledge and subject matter expert in the area related to the Franchise
- Strategic Thinking: Strategic planning and interfacing for complex or critical products; capable of developing a clear strategy to maximize within both existing clients and a new client base; impact of regulatory changes on internal processes and products; clear, comprehensive understanding of the link between department/function and business strategy
- People Development: Actively engages in talent management practices (selection, promotion, development, and engagement) to cultivate a workforce that is well aligned with current and emerging talent needs
- Relationship Management: Builds and sustains partnerships across organizational boundaries and functions as well as outside the organization to achieve common goals and outcomes
- Research/Problem Solving: Leads through analysis of situations with appropriate attention to detail and the big picture including consideration of impact at multiple levels of the system, ability to work in a creative manner to identify unique solutions
- Communication: Written, verbal and presentation; ability to engage, inspire, and influence people
- Project Management: Able to provide oversight within large and complex products to ensure quality, delivery, and high levels of client satisfaction.
